Description
Prosaptide Tx14(A), a prosaposin-derived peptide, is a potent
GPR37L1
and
GPR37
agonist with
EC
50
s of 5 and 7 nM, respectively. Prosaptide Tx14(A) increases both ERK1 and ERK2 phosphorylation in Schwann cells
